Department of Veterans' Affairs (DVA)
Veterans can access services at no cost when referred through DVA. A D904 referral form must be completed by your GP or specialist. This referral covers psychosocial support, case management, and practical assistance. If you're unsure where to start, we can guide you through the process.

NDIS Participants
If you’re an NDIS participant, we can support you under Capacity Building – Improved Daily Living. Sessions can be delivered at home, online, or in your local community. We work closely with your support team to help you reach your goals.

DVA Rehabilitation Plans
If you're on a DVA rehab plan, psychosocial services and case management may be covered under your support program. Speak with your DVA rehabilitation consultant about referring to Mindful Mates.
